Mold Spores & Toxins
 
Molds may resemble plants, but they are actually fungi. They are a natural and important part of our environment. Many live in the soil and help decompose dead and decaying matter. They can also grow indoors. For example, you may have seen mold growing on old bread, cheese or other foods. It also grows on grout in between tiles, in showers, on wallpaper, drywall, leather, clothing, books, wood, etc. As mold grows, it produces microscopic spores (similar to seeds) that are released into the air. When these spores find good conditions to grow, they form new mold colonies and the process repeats itself.

Since mold grows on so many items in so many places, we are constantly breathing its spores. Usually, our bodies can handle the spores just fine. However, frequent exposure to high enough concentrations can make a person’s body sensitive to the mold, causing the person to become allergic. Spores can also carry toxins that in small doses over time, or in a single high dose, may harm a person’s health.

While there will always be mold spores (similar to seeds) present in indoor air, mold growth in homes is undesirable. In the presence of enough moisture and food, molds can grow quickly to produce unfavorable conditions including allergies, respiratory distress and damage to property.
